Բովանդակություն:

DIY WiFi խելացի վարդակից ՝ 7 քայլ (նկարներով)
DIY WiFi խելացի վարդակից ՝ 7 քայլ (նկարներով)

Video: DIY WiFi խելացի վարդակից ՝ 7 քայլ (նկարներով)

Video: DIY WiFi խելացի վարդակից ՝ 7 քայլ (նկարներով)
Video: 5 ՀՐԱՇԱԼԻ ԿՅԱՆՔԻ ՀԱՔԵՐ #2 2024, Նոյեմբեր
Anonim
DIY WiFi խելացի վարդակից
DIY WiFi խելացի վարդակից

Սա Smart Plug-point է ՝ ջերմաստիճանի խոնավության տվիչ DHT 11 և արտակարգ իրավիճակների LED լույսով: Ինչպես միշտ, այս վարդակից կարելի է միացնել և անջատել ցանկացած սմարթֆոնի WiFi- ի միջոցով: Սա կարող է նաև միացվել ինտերնետին և օգտվել որպես «Իրերի ինտերնետ» (IOT) գործառույթից:

Առանձնահատկություններ, ներառյալ.

1. Ներկառուցված ջերմաստիճանի խոնավության ցուցիչ

2. Շրջանցման անջատիչ `վարդակից ուղղակիորեն աշխատելու համար

3. Կայուն ESP8266 PCB

4. 230VAC- ից 3.3VDC ներառված ներսում

5. Wifi գործարկվող արտակարգ իրավիճակների LED լույս

6. Երրորդ կողմի ծրագրակազմի օգտագործումը կարող է անջատել և կտրել նոութբուքի կամ սմարթֆոնի լիցքավորիչի մարտկոցի որոշակի մակարդակի վրա:

7. Փոքր, հարմար և կոմպակտ:

Քայլ 1: Անհրաժեշտ մասեր

Պահանջվող մասեր
Պահանջվող մասեր
Պահանջվող մասեր
Պահանջվող մասեր
Պահանջվող մասեր
Պահանջվող մասեր
Պահանջվող մասեր
Պահանջվող մասեր

ՄԱՍՆԱԿԻ. ՄԻTERԱEDԳԱՅԻՆ

1. ESP-12F կամ ESP-12E

2. Copper Clad board + Etchant

3. AMS1117 3.3V Լարման կարգավորիչ

4. 1k և 3528 Red SMD Resistor և LED

5. 10uF, 100uF, 220uF, 0.1uFx2, 470uF կոնդենսատորներ

6. 10kOhm դիմադրություն

7. 15 Օմ դիմադրություն

8. 1 Channel 5V ռելեի տախտակ (ես ինքս եմ պատրաստել)

9. 230 Վ -ից 5 Վ Nokia լիցքավորման լիցքավորման մոդուլ

10. LED Driver Circuit

  • Berg շերտի կապում
  • PC817 օպտիկական միակցիչ
  • 2x 470 Օմ դիմադրություն
  • 2N2222 տրանզիստոր

11. 5V LED ժապավեն

12. Բերգի ժապավեն

13. Dupont Female to Female լարերը

14. 1 x 2 Way Wago միակցիչ

15. 1 x Իգական 3 Pin վարդակից

16. DHT11 կամ DHT22 տվիչ

17. 1 x 6A Շրջել անջատիչ

18. Պլաստիկ պատյան

19. Ապահովող պտուտակներ

20. 1 x Cable Gland

21. 1 x 3 Pin Plug

22. Հարմար երկարության 3 առանցքային մետաղալար

23. 1 հիմնական մետաղալար 1 մետր (AC միացումների համար)

Քայլ 2: Նախապատրաստում

Պատրաստում
Պատրաստում
Պատրաստում
Պատրաստում
Պատրաստում
Պատրաստում

Պատրաստման առարկաներ.

1. ESP-12 PCB

2. Արտակարգ իրավիճակների LED վարորդ

ESP-12 PCB

Գտեք PCB- ի սխեմատիկային կցվածը: Ներառել են լազերային տպիչի տոներ փոխանցման մեթոդի ֆայլերը:

www.instructables.com/id/PCB-ETCHING-TONER…

Վերոնշյալ հրահանգը կուղղորդի PCB փորագրելու համար:

Ես ընդլայնել եմ հետքերը ՝ հեշտ փորագրման համար:

Sոդել բաղադրիչները:

LED Վարորդ

Կցված սխեմատիկ, կետի տախտակի վրա զոդված, 5V- ով կանցնի LED ժապավեն, երբ ESP8266- ից 3.3V ազդանշանը կստանա օպտիկական զույգը:

ԷԼԵԿՏՐԱՄԱՌՈՅ

Կարգավորումը միացնելու համար ես վերցրեցի Nokia- ի հին լիցքավորիչը, բացեցի այն և վերցրի սնուցման տախտակը: 0ոդված լարեր 230V- ի համար և տեղադրված berg շերտի կապում `5V ելքի համար:

RELAY BOARD

Ավելի էժան է գնել պատրաստի 5V օպտոիզոլացված ռելեային տախտակ: Ես ունեի մեկը, որը երկար ժամանակ հետ էի պատրաստել:

Քայլ 3: Fրագրակազմի բեռնում

Շնորհիվ ESPEASY որոնվածի, որն ինձ ազատում է Arduino կոդավորումից:

Ստորև բերված է քայլ առ քայլ ընթացակարգ ՝ որոնվածը հեշտությամբ ESP8266- ում բեռնելու համար:

www.letscontrolit.com/wiki/index.php/Tutor…

Քայլ 4: Հավաքում

Հավաքում
Հավաքում
Հավաքում
Հավաքում
Հավաքում
Հավաքում
Հավաքում
Հավաքում

Կախված պարիսպից, կտրեք այն ՝ առջևում տեղադրելով կանացի վարդակը, փորագրված ESP-12 PCB և LED ժապավեն:

Ես տեղադրել եմ DHT11 սենսորը և շրջանցման շրջադարձի անջատիչը պարիսպի կողքին:

Հորատել եք 7 մմ տրամագծով անցք ՝ DHT11 լարերը անցնելու համար:

Վերին մասում 3 միջուկի մետաղալար ՝ 3 պին վարդակով, որը միացնում է պարիսպը մալուխային գեղձի միջոցով:

Տեղադրեք ձեր պարիսպին համապատասխանող բաղադրիչները:

Քայլ 5: Միացում

Միացում
Միացում
Միացում
Միացում
Միացում
Միացում
Միացում
Միացում

Միացեք դուպոնտ իգական կանացի լարերին, որտեղ էլ որ օգտագործվեն բերգ շերտի կապում:

Համոզվեք, որ AC- ի համար օգտագործում եք ստանդարտ լարեր

Օգտագործեք wago երկկողմանի միակցիչ ՝ AC աղբյուրի համար, ռելեի միացում, շրջադարձային անջատիչ միացում, 230V դեպի 5V: Քանի որ լարերը համեմատաբար բարակ են, ես 2 լար լարել եմ wago միակցիչի 1 եղանակով:

Չեզոքը պտուտակված է իգական վարդակին և 230 Վ -ից մինչև 5 Վ նույնպես պտուտակված է նույն կանացի վարդակին, որտեղ դրա համար բավականաչափ տեղ կա:

ESP-12- ի GPIO 13-ը գնում է DHT11 ՝ օգտագործելով dupont

ESP-12- ի GPIO 12-ը գնում է RelayBoard ՝ օգտագործելով dupont

ESP-12- ի GPIO 14-ը անցնում է LED վարորդին ՝ օգտագործելով dupont

DHT11- ը սնուցվում է ESP-12- ի ելքի միջոցով, քանի որ այն աշխատում է 3.3 Վ լարման վրա

Ռելեի տախտակը և LED վարորդը ուղղակիորեն սնուցվում են լիցքավորիչի մոդուլից 5 Վ լարման միջոցով:

Քայլ 6: Կազմաձևում և փորձարկում

Կազմաձևում և փորձարկում
Կազմաձևում և փորձարկում
Կազմաձևում և փորձարկում
Կազմաձևում և փորձարկում
Կազմաձևում և փորձարկում
Կազմաձևում և փորձարկում

Ես կցել եմ HTML ֆայլը ՝ TEMP, HUMIDITY, գործառնական վարդակից և արտակարգ իրավիճակների լուսադիոդները դիտելու համար:

Առաջին բեռնման կարգաբերման համար ESP-12- ը ՝ ստորև հղման հրահանգների համաձայն

www.letscontrolit.com/wiki/index.php/ESPEa…

Լռելյայն կցված HTML IP հասցեն սահմանվում է ինքնուրույն ռեժիմի համար: Սա պետք է փոխվի, եթե ESP- ը միացված է երթուղիչին:

Քանի որ այն IOT սարք է, ինտերնետ երթուղիչին միանալիս, սարքը միևնույն IP- ին դնել, երբ ավելի շատ սարքեր միացված են (դա կարելի է անել, երթուղիչի կազմաձևման էջ) և այդ IP- ն մուտքագրել կցված ֆայլի HTML խմբագրիչում (Գրառման գրքույկ): Օր. Փոխարինել 192.168.4.1 -ը 192.168.1.xxx- ով (ինչ էլ որ լինի)

Հետևեք այս քայլին և ավելացրեք DHT11 տվիչի տվյալները ESP-12- ին

www.letscontrolit.com/wiki/index.php/DHT11…

230VAC տալուց առաջ, ըստ նախորդ քայլի, միացնելուց հետո միացրեք 5VDC- ը DC կապերին `վարքագիծը և հզորությունը ստուգելու համար:

Հետագայում միացված է AC հոսանքի աղբյուրին և փորձարկվում է AC LED LAMP- ով:

Այնուհետև փորձարկեք նավի վրա գտնվող LED- ը:

Քայլ 7: Նոթբուքի ավտոմատ անջատում և անջատում կարգավորում

Երրորդ կողմի կիրառմամբ Battery Deley և Curl հրամանի տողն ինքնաբերաբար անջատում է վարդակը, երբ մարտկոցի մակարդակը հասնում է 90% -ի և միացնում վարդակը, երբ մարտկոցի մակարդակը հասնում է 16% -ի:

Դուք կարող եք մուտքագրել ձեր սեփական տիրույթը:

Կցված փոստային հասցեն նախապես կազմաձևված է իմ IP հասցեի համար, պարզապես փոխարինեք IP հասցեն ձեր ESP IP հասցեով BatteryDeley.ini ֆայլում:

Նմանապես այնպիսի ծրագրեր, ինչպիսիք են Tasker- ը, IFTTT- ը android- ի համար, կարող են նույնը անել Android սմարթֆոնների համար:

Եթե կասկածներ կամ ուղղումներ ունեք, մեկնաբանեք կամ ուղարկեք ինձ @

-Կումարան

Խորհուրդ ենք տալիս: